mental wholeness

It is equally important that we take care of our mental health as well as our physical and spiritual bodies. 


Listed are a few resources to help you find the right therapist for yourself or someone you know who may benefit from these services.


Temple Behavioral Health P.C. Their focus is to help individuals heal, energize, and become aware of their inner strengths. This is achieved by providing a neutral safe space, listening to your concerns, and customizing a treatment plan.  https://tbhpc.com/


Absolutely FREE.  There MISSION is Connecting Black therapists with Black and African American individuals who lack adequate funds or health insurance. Absolutely free.

https://www.freeblacktherapy.org/


Therapy For Black Girls; Find trusted, culturally competent therapists that know our feelings and can help navigate being a strong, black woman.

https://therapyforblackgirls.com/


Healed Men Heal Men; Their Mission is To provide access to mental health treatment, psycho-education, and community resources to men of color. 

https://blackmenheal.org/


African Americans, Afro-Caribbean Americans, And Addiction

African Americans and Afro-Caribbean Americans account for a large portion of the United States population. Substance abuse patterns in both African American and Afro-Caribbean American groups differ greatly based on cultures, spirituality, and social views. There are distinct differences in cultures and attitudes that contribute to substance abuse discrepancies in these communities.
